Association of joint line changes with patient-reported outcomes after cruciate-retaining robotic arm-assisted total knee arthroplasty with functional alignment.

PURPOSE Robotic arm-assisted total knee arthroplasty (R-TKA) enables precise bone resection and real-time intraoperative gap adjustment, facilitating functional alignment (FA). However, performing FA with standardized implants may cause unintended changes in the joint line (JL), and their clinical relevance remains unclear. This study aimed to evaluate the association between compartment-specific JL changes and postoperative patient-reported outcomes after R-TKA with FA. METHODS This retrospective study included 147 knees that underwent primary cruciate retaining (CR) R-TKA with FA. JL height was defined as the perpendicular distance from the transepicondylar axis to the most distal aspect of the femoral condyles on preoperative and postoperative computed tomography images. Patients were categorized into elevation, neutral, or depression groups based on a 2-mm deviation from the native JL in the medial and lateral compartments. Patient-reported outcomes were measured 1 year after surgery. RESULTS Mean JL depression occurred in both compartments, with a greater change in the lateral compartment (3.1 ± 2.5 vs. 1.8 ± 2.5 mm). Among the groups in the medial compartment, the elevation group had the lowest Forgotten Joint Score-12 scores (mean difference = 28.5 points, Cohen's d = 1.09). In contrast, lateral JL changes were not significantly associated with 1-year patient-reported outcomes. Final gap asymmetry values were comparable among medial JL subgroups. CONCLUSION Although JL depression was relatively well tolerated, medial JL elevation was associated with worse 1-year patient-reported outcomes after CR R-TKA with FA. These findings suggest that unnecessary medial JL elevation may warrant caution, whereas modest JL depression may be acceptable when needed to achieve balanced gaps.
